What is Podcasting?

Podcasting is radio's answer to TiVo. Unlike streaming radio, which requires real time listening, Podcasting lets you hear some of your favorite KFOG programs in other than "real" time. It allows you to receive automatic, FREE, downloads of select KFOG content (in mp3 format) directly to your desktop or laptop computer and on to your iPod or other MP3 player.

At this time, licensing and publishing fees for most commercially released music have not been determined, so KFOG cannot make our music programs available to you via Podcasting. When this situation is resolved, look for more KFOG programming to be made available to you.

Do I have to have an iPod?

No, Podcasts work on almost all mp3 players but by using iTunes and an iPod, you will have the easiest possible access to our KFOG Podcasts. If all you want to do is listen from your computer, you won't even need a portable mp3 player. Just click on the desired media player. It's that easy.
